Types of Paint Finishes

Flat

Flat finishes offer a non-reflective appearance, providing a smooth, velvety look. It’s great for hiding imperfections on walls but is less durable and more challenging to clean, making it unideal for a bathroom. 

Eggshell

Eggshell finishes are slightly more reflective than flat, they have a subtle sheen resembling an eggshell. They tend to be more washable than flat finishes and work well in living rooms and bedrooms.

Satin

Provides a soft, pearl-like sheen that is more durable and easier to clean than eggshell. These finishes are a popular choice for high-traffic areas, including kitchens, bathrooms, and hallways.

Semi-Gloss

Offers a noticeable shine and is highly durable and moisture-resistant. Tends to be the best finish for bathroom paint as it can withstand frequent cleaning and exposure to moisture.

High Gloss

Provides a shiny, reflective finish and is the most durable and scrubbable option. Best for areas that require frequent cleaning, such as doors, cabinets, and trim.

What Is the Best Paint Finish for Bathrooms? 

When deciding what paint finish for bathrooms is ideal, consider factors like ease of cleaning and mold resistance, as these areas are high-moisture environments. The best paint finish for bathroom walls includes semi-gloss or satin, as finishes handle water splashes and steam well. Additionally, these finishes make cleaning easy, reduce the risk of mold and mildew growth, and keep bathroom walls looking fresh by resisting frequent wear and tear. Thus, when asking what paint finish is best for bathroom walls, semi-gloss and satin are often the best paint finishes for bathroom walls.
